Occupational respiratory diseases in the South African ...
Jan 24, 2013· A total of 12,241 men in the PATHAUT database had worked in the platinum-mining industry from 1975 to 2009. As for the diamond mine workers, a thorough search of all available data sources produced no evidence of employment in another mining sector for 6,490 (53%) of the platinum mine workers; 85 (2.2%) had silicosis at autopsy.

Environmental impact of mining - Wikipedia
Environmental impacts of mining can occur at local, regional, and global scales through direct and indirect mining practices. Impacts can result in erosion, sinkholes, loss of biodiversity, or the contamination of soil, groundwater, and surface water by the chemicals emitted from mining processes.
